SORTING SNACKS MINI FRIDGE
![](https://thetoyinsider.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/09/LEARNING_RESOURCES_SORTING_SNACKS_MINI_FRIDGE_TI2023.webp)
Kids can open this fridge-shaped playset to discover 30 miniature foods in five colors, along with five shopping baskets. Kids can use these to practice counting, sorting, identifying patterns, and other learning skills.

MAGIC ADVENTURES TELESCOPE
![](https://thetoyinsider.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/09/LEAPFROG_MAGIC_ADVENTURES_TELESCOPE_TI2023.webp)
Kids can look through the digital telescope at up to 110-times magnification to explore the world around them, check out more than 100 NASA videos and images, and play games on the 2.4-inch screen. 5+

CODE+CONTROL DINOSAUR ROBOT: REX
![](https://thetoyinsider.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/THAMES-KOSMOS_CODECONTROL-DINOSAUR-ROBOT-REX_TI_2023-1.webp)
Kids can assemble their own robotic model of a T. rex, then use the controller to command the robot to move around in all directions, light up its eyes, and play sounds, including chowing down on food and farting.

PROFESSOR MAXWELL’S VR ATLAS
![](https://thetoyinsider.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/03/VR_Atlas_Hero_Updated-jpg.webp)
Discover the world in virtual reality with this 138-page interactive illustrated atlas for kids. Kids can explore points of interest, landmarks, and world wonders in augmented and virtual reality.
